When you get a quote for exterior painting, the total depends on a few practical things. The size and height of your home are the biggest factors—a multi-story house takes more time and safety equipment. The current condition of your siding also matters; if there is significant peeling, wood rot, or mold, that area needs extra prep work before a brush ever touches it. Summer offers the best conditions for drying, but extreme heat can be an issue. If it’s too hot, paint might dry too quickly, which keeps it from bonding to the surface. We often schedule painting for earlier in the day to avoid the peak afternoon sun and keep the finish looking smooth.

The best exterior paint for a Madison home should offer good protection against humidity, rain, and temperature swings. High-quality acrylic latex paints are generally recommended for their durability and flexibility.
